PHOENIX – Nancy J. Corley, daughter of Walter and Clara Doyle, passed away on June 19, 2020 in Phoenix at the age of 84. Nancy was a second generation Phoenician who grew up on her family’s farm in the west valley. She attended Cartwright grade school and graduated from West High.

Nancy’s idyllic childhood and genuine love for family motivated her deeply to devote herself to being the best homemaker and mother she could be. She poured herself into raising her children and loved them well. She had a caregiver’s heart and often stepped forward to care for others in her extended family. She enjoyed hosting family gatherings and participat­ing in a variety of league sports such as bowling, golf and tennis.

After her children were raised Nancy began her career with the State of Arizona and retired in December of 1999 as the Human Resources Assistant Director for the Attorney General’s office. Once retired Nancy spent summers at her beloved cabin in Christophe­r Creek where she could be found playing cards or Rummikub with family or friends nearly every day.

Nancy is survived by her children Kayelen Rolfe and Kevin Corley; her grandsons Brandon and Nathan Corley; and her sisters Shirley Quist and Marlys Arnould; as well as numerous nieces and nephews.

Nancy was laid to rest next to her parents in a private family burial at Green Acres Memorial Park. A Celebratio­n of Life will be held in Christophe­r Creek or the surroundin­g area in early fall.
